27 connections·40 entities in this video→Leaked Messages Expose Young Republican Extremism
- ✉️ Thousands of private messages from a Telegram chat among young Republican leaders in Arizona, New York, Kansas, and Vermont have been leaked and obtained by Politico.
- 💬 The exchanges, spanning seven months, reveal racist, anti-Semitic, and misogynistic comments, including jokes about gas chambers, slavery, and rape.
- 🗣️ Participants used racial slurs, referred to Black people as "monkeys" or "the watermelon people," and expressed admiration for Hitler.
- 🧑💼 The group includes individuals described as "leaders" in young Republican state organizations, with ages ranging from 18 to 40.
Specific Examples of Offensive Remarks
- 🚫 William Hendricks, Kansas Young Republicans vice chair, reportedly used variations of the n-word over a dozen times.
- ⚖️ Peter Gionta, former chair of the New York State Young Republicans, wrote that those who vote "no" are going to the gas chamber.
- 🔥 Joe Merlino, former counsel for the New York Young Republicans, responded to the gas chamber comment by asking, "Can we fix the showers? Gas chambers don't fit the Hitler esthetic."
- 🎭 Annie Kaye Katie, a New York Republican National Committee member, stated, "I'm ready to watch people burn."
Trump Administration Official Involved
- 🏢 Michael Bartels, who works for the Trump administration as an advisor in the US Small Business Administration, was identified as being part of the chat.
- 🚫 Despite Politico's report, Donald Trump has taken no action against Bartels, who declined to comment.
Political Reactions and JD Vance's Stance
- 📢 Senate Democratic Minority Leader Chuck Schumer condemned the leaked conversations as "revolting" and "disgusting," calling for swift and unequivocal condemnation from all Republican leaders.
- 🤷 JD Vance, however, did not condemn the group chat, instead posting screenshots from years ago of a Democrat and stating, "I refuse to join the pearl clutching when powerful people call for political violence."
- 🎯 Vance's defense backfired, drawing criticism from both Democrats and conservatives like Jonah Goldberg, who called it "moral cowardice and sophistry."
